Summary Introduction
Case summary:
Person X is decided to start a company relating to software products which integrates a wide range of media devices like laptops, desktop computers, cell phones and digital video recorders. He has selected student body at his university as an initial market.
Once his plans are successful and he will decide to expand its business to other colleges and areas and eventually to go national wide. Later he will plan to go public issue with an IPO to buy a yacht. These points are kept in mind while deciding the potential investors of his company.
To discuss: Whether agency problem exists, when person X has hired some people to help while expanding the business.

Skip Stephens is trying to decide whether it would be wise to consolidate his debt by borrowing funds from Syndicated Lending, a firm that he doesn’t know much about. Syndicated is an Internet lender that doesn’t post much information about the costs of the loans it offers. Some of the additional information Skip has gathered from various sources suggests the Syndicated might use such unethical practices as “bait and switch” to attract customers.
Discussion questions:
Is there an ethical problem? If so, what is it?
What are the implications if Skip borrows from Syndicated?
Should Skip borrow from Syndicated?
